WebMay 16, 2012 · Pulping coffee. Pulping is usually done within 24 hours of harvesting the coffee cherry (fruit), and involves removing the outer flesh of the coffee cherry (the red skin and the mucilaginous pulp). This is usually done with a machine known as a pulper which uses rough rollers to loosen and break up the outer part of the cherry. The product obtained via wet processing (known as coffee pulp) consists of the outer skin, the pulp, with limited amount of mucilage. WebMar 15, 2024 · When you take the seeds out of the coffee cherry fruit, some pulp remains with the skin. When the skin and pulp are dried, it is also called coffee cherry tea or cascara. How is coffee cherry tea (cascara) flavor? Cascara is another name for coffee cherry tea. And this is a herbal tea that tastes great like cider, hibiscus, or orange zest.
